          Speeding Up Speech Doesn’t Speed Up Brain Processing

          New research shows that when people listen to speech at different speeds, the auditory cortex does not adjust its timing but instead processes sound in a fixed time window. This discovery challenges the long-standing idea that the brain flexibly adapts its processing pace to match speech rhythms.

          When Music Falls Flat: Why Some Brains Don’t Enjoy Music

          Some people feel absolutely nothing when listening to music—and not because of bad taste. A rare condition called specific musical anhedonia involves a disconnect between the brain's auditory and reward systems, making music emotionally flat even though other rewards like food or money still trigger pleasure.

          How the Brain Links Sound to Meaning

          A new study has mapped how the brain retrieves words during speech, identifying two distinct but overlapping networks in the prefrontal cortex. Researchers used high-resolution electrocorticography in 48 patients to reveal that semantic processing and articulatory planning occur in neighboring yet functionally distinct regions.

          Vagus Nerve Stimulation Can Boost Perceptual Learning

          New research demonstrates that stimulating the vagus nerve enhances perceptual learning, allowing animals to better distinguish subtle sensory differences over time. In the study, mice trained to differentiate tones improved more when their vagus nerve was stimulated, surpassing performance plateaus seen in unstimulated mice. This stimulation activated regions in the brain associated with attention, memory, and neuroplasticity, suggesting it might enhance adaptability to new experiences.

          Classical Music Synchronizes Brain Waves, Improving Depression

          Western classical music can significantly affect brain activity, particularly in people with treatment-resistant depression. By measuring brainwaves and neural imaging, scientists discovered that music synchronizes neural oscillations between brain regions associated with sensory and emotional processing, enhancing mood. This study suggests that personalized music therapy could be a powerful tool for treating depression, especially when integrated with other sensory stimuli.

          Brain Region Helps Tune Our Hearing to Focus on Important Sounds

          A new study uncovers how the orbitofrontal cortex (OFC) aids the auditory cortex in adapting to different hearing contexts. Researchers found that the OFC sends signals to the auditory cortex to help switch between passive and active listening. This discovery enhances our understanding of how the brain filters and reacts to sounds, with implications for treating neurodevelopmental disorders. The findings highlight the OFC's crucial role in managing auditory attention.

          Supranormal Hearing Achieved by Boosting Ear Synapses

          Researchers have enhanced auditory processing in young mice by increasing inner ear synapses using neurotrophin-3. This study supports the hypothesis that synapse density impacts hidden hearing loss in humans. The findings could lead to new treatments for hearing disorders by preserving or regenerating synapses. The study reveals that boosting synapses not only improves hearing but also enhances auditory information processing.

          How The Brain Predicts Music

          A new study reveals how our brains recognize and predict musical sequences, activating areas related to sound, memory, and emotions. This understanding could help develop tools to detect cognitive decline and dementia. The study measured brainwaves of 83 participants, showing the complex neural processes involved in music perception. Future research will explore how these mechanisms change with age and cognitive impairments.

          How Our Brains Process Music

          Researchers unlocked how the brain processes melodies, creating a detailed map of auditory cortex activity. Their study reveals that the brain engages in dual tasks when hearing music: tracking pitch with neurons used for speech and predicting future notes with music-specific neurons.
